I chose mine because he accepts American Express points. I will save $3000 off the price of my cruise. I went ahead and booked a full suite because of this. Nine sea days and we will make good use of it.

 

The extras I received from my TA are:

 

Free shore excursion (up to $100)

OBC $85

bottle of wine

 

American Express will give me a $300 OBC because I booked a suite.

 

Next, I will look into opening a Princess credit card to receive their benefits.

We can't recommend TAs on Cruise Critic but I would suggest you go to some of the websites and get an idea of prices. Then call some of your local TAs and see what incentives they might have to encourage you to book with them.
